Cost of Living: Hermitage, PA vs Clarendon, TX
Housing
The housing market plays a significant role in determining the cost of living.
| Metric | Hermitage | Clarendon |
|---|---|---|
| Housing Index | 100.9 | 98.2 |
| Median Home Price | $94,500 | $100,000 |
| Average Rent (2 BR Apartment) | $1511 | $1563 |
| Average Rent (2 BR House) | $1642 | $1699 |
Housing Comparison: Hermitage vs Clarendon
- The median home price in Clarendon is higher at $100,000, compared to $94,500 in Hermitage.
- In Clarendon, the rental for a two-bedroom apartment stands at $1,563, while it is $1,511 in Hermitage.
Utilities
The cost of utilities such as electricity, natural gas, and other services can significantly impact the overall cost of living.
| Metric | Hermitage | Clarendon |
|---|---|---|
| Electricity Price | $17.68 | $14.47 |
| Natural Gas Price | $17.61 | $26.29 |
| Other Utilities | $241 | $235 |
Utilities Comparison: Hermitage vs Clarendon
- Electricity costs are higher in Hermitage at $17.68 per kWh, compared to $14.47 in Clarendon.
- Clarendon experiences higher natural gas costs at $26.29 per unit, with costs at $17.61 in Hermitage.
- Other utility costs are higher in Hermitage at an average of $241, compared to Clarendon with $235.
